<#PSScriptInfo .VERSION 1.2.1 .GUID d6d491d2-400a-47a4-a2c6-e865a634b830 .AUTHOR vadyaravadim .COMPANYNAME .COPYRIGHT .TAGS Windows Windows10 Windows11 Gaming TimerResolution HPET DynamicTick Latency Performance Stutter Tweak .LICENSEURI https://github.com/vadyaravadim/timer-resolution-utility/blob/main/LICENSE .PROJECTURI https://github.com/vadyaravadim/timer-resolution-utility .ICONURI .EXTERNALMODULEDEPENDENCIES .REQUIREDSCRIPTS .EXTERNALSCRIPTDEPENDENCIES .RELEASENOTES .PRIVATEDATA #> <# .SYNOPSIS Windows timer stack manager: timer resolution, dynamic tick, HPET. .DESCRIPTION Shows the current state of the Windows timer stack (timer resolution, bcdedit timer tweaks, HPET, Windows 11 global resolution requests), measures real Sleep(1) precision, and applies the tweaks you select in a grid - each one opt-in, with a JSON undo file and a full BCD backup written before any change. Zero external dependencies. .PARAMETER Status Show the timer status and exit (no tweak grid). .PARAMETER Measure Benchmark Sleep(1) precision at the current and at the maximum timer resolution, then exit. Does not require Administrator. .PARAMETER Samples Sample count for -Measure (default 30). .PARAMETER Undo Revert the changes recorded in the newest timer_undo_*.json file. .NOTES bcdedit and registry changes need a reboot; the holder task takes effect immediately. After several runs, undo files are per-run snapshots: apply them newest-to-oldest - only the oldest holds the original state. #> [CmdletBinding()] param( [switch]$Status, [switch]$Measure, [int]$Samples = 30, [switch]$Undo, [switch]$Hold, # internal: used by the scheduled task to keep max resolution requested [switch]$Elevated, # internal: set by the self-elevation relaunch [string]$LogonUser # internal: the pre-elevation user, for the holder task binding ) $ErrorActionPreference = 'Stop' $TaskName = 'timer-resolution-utility-holder' $KernelKey = 'HKLM:\SYSTEM\CurrentControlSet\Control\Session Manager\kernel' $GlobalValue = 'GlobalTimerResolutionRequests' $IsWin11 = [Environment]::OSVersion.Version.Build -ge 22000 # Keep the self-elevated window open so the user can read the output. function Wait-IfElevatedWindow { if ($Elevated) { Read-Host "Press Enter to close" | Out-Null } } # Without this, an unhandled error closes the self-elevated window before # the user can read the message. trap { Write-Host "ERROR: $_" -ForegroundColor Red Wait-IfElevatedWindow # Under `irm | iex` this runs inside the user's own session, where `exit` # would close their console - rethrow so only the piped script stops. if ($PSCommandPath) { exit 1 } break } # Mode switches forwarded on every relaunch (the irm|iex bootstrap rerun below # and the self-elevation later) - one list so neither path can silently drop one. function Get-ForwardedSwitchList { $a = @() if ($Status) { $a += '-Status' } if ($Measure) { $a += '-Measure', '-Samples', $Samples } if ($Undo) { $a += '-Undo' } $a } # Launched via `irm <url> | iex` - no file on disk.
